The Basics of What’s Included
When considering a cruise package deal, it’s crucial to grasp what typically comes included in your booking. A standard cruise package often covers essentials like accommodation, dining options, on-board activities, entertainment, and port fees. However, specific inclusions can vary based on the cruise line and the type of package you choose.
These packages usually encompass your stay in a cozy cabin or stateroom, granting you access to a range of dining venues offering diverse culinary experiences. From casual buffets to elegant sit-down dinners, cruise dining caters to different tastes and preferences. Additionally, onboard activities such as pools, fitness centers, spas, and entertainment shows are commonly part of the deal, ensuring a well-rounded vacation experience.
Remember, while many amenities are included, certain extras like specialty dining, alcoholic beverages, shore excursions, gratuities, and Wi-Fi may entail additional charges. It’s advisable to review the specific inclusions of your chosen package to avoid unexpected expenses and make the most of your cruise vacation.

The Truth About Flights and Cruises
Cruise-Only Pricing Explained
When you’re looking at cruise packages, you might come across “cruise-only” prices. This means that the cost you see is for the cruise itself without any additional components like flights. It’s essential to understand that not all cruises include flights in their pricing structure. So, if you opt for a cruise-only package, you’ll need to arrange your airfare separately. This approach can give you more flexibility in choosing your flights, allowing you to select preferred airlines or routes.
How Cruise Lines Handle Airfare
Cruise lines typically offer two main options concerning airfare: they can either include flights as part of a package or provide you with the choice to book your flights independently. When flights are included, the convenience factor is high as the cruise line handles all the arrangements, making it a hassle-free experience for you. However, keep in mind that the cost of flights might be bundled into the overall price, so it’s crucial to compare prices to ensure you’re getting a good deal.
If you prefer to have more control over your flight selections or if you have specific airline preferences or frequent flyer benefits, opting for booking your airfare independently might be the best choice for you. This allows you to tailor your travel arrangements according to your needs and possibly find better deals. Remember to consider factors like departure times, layovers, and overall travel comfort when deciding on your airfare options.

Premium and Luxury Cruise Lines Services
Premium and luxury cruise lines often include flights as part of their upscale service offerings. When you book with these cruise lines, you can expect a higher level of convenience and customization in your travel arrangements. They may offer business class or first-class flights, private transfers, and even charter flights for exclusive experiences.
For instance, premium cruise lines like Seabourn or Regent Seven Seas Cruises are known for providing complimentary flights for guests booked in certain suite categories or offering airfare credits as part of their loyalty programs. These services cater to travelers looking for a seamless and luxurious travel experience from start to finish.
